Celebrate Wimbledon Finals with Seaton Tramway

28th June 2011 Print

People are invited to get into the spirit of summer with a range of activities and delicious summer treats at Seaton Tramway, all to celebrate Wimbledon Finals Week from Monday 27 June.

Everyone at Seaton is entering into the spirit of this great summer tradition and a tempting range of refreshments are being served on the terrace at the Tramstop Restaurant throughout Wimbledon Finals Week.

People are invited to come along to the Tramstop Restaurant at Colyton Station and choose from delightfully fruity Pimms cocktails, sumptuous local strawberries and cream or wickedly indulgent cream teas whilst listening to the live match action, which will be played out over the radio so people can enjoy the full Wimbledon experience all week long.

Managing director of Seaton Tramway, Jenny Nunn said, “We hold many events during the year and Wimbledon Finals Week is always great fun.  We’ll be sure to have plenty of strawberries and cream available for people to enjoy while they sit back and listen to the live match coverage on the radio.

“The Tramstop Restaurant will be decorated especially for the occasion and we’d love to see people coming along in their tennis whites to join in the fun.” 

The fleet of 14 electric trams, many of which have been restored, will be running every day, transporting people along the Axe estuary on the three mile route between Seaton and Colyton.  

Return tickets between Seaton and Colyton are £8.75 for adults, £8 for seniors and students, and £4 for children. It is also possible to travel all day for just £1 extra per adult and 50p extra for per child. Trams run daily from 10.00 until 17.00 at Seaton and 17.30 at Colyton. Some trams have been restored and adapted for wheelchair access and usually, at least one will be running every hour. Seaton Tramway has won a range of tourism and environmental awards and accreditations including the national Green Tourism Business Scheme, Welcome Host, Devon County Council’s Get wild about Devon and quality assurance as a Devon top attraction and from enjoyEngland.com. Seaton Tramway is a Heritage Railway Association Member and a member of the Confederation of Passenger Transport.
